Transaction 4ed12e0463a15138ffc51a47814307a08cddb34b6110c3ab58139aaa5ebc1a74
1 Input
2 Outputs
- 4ed12e0463a15138ffc51a47814307a08cddb34b6110c3ab58139aaa5ebc1a74:0
- 4ed12e0463a15138ffc51a47814307a08cddb34b6110c3ab58139aaa5ebc1a74:1
value 2507032
address 1FEMZAa9nBrs1jcsNocb4yTXKDAzuBU1pv
value 945750846
address 1EZ7bjGWe8S8djaAiCY8roavrKyrirmgQB